Numerous studies have shown that ADHD sufferers may experience negative side effects due to frequent changes in treatment or medication. Therefore, doctors should monitor their patients' moods and modify their treatment plans according to the needs.

A recent study reviewed claims data from 122,881 individuals with ADHD. The study revealed that, on average, the patients had a median age of 29.3 years. Half of the patients changed their treatment during the span of 12 months.

The most common reasons for treatment changes included discontinuation of medication, management of ADHD/treatment-related complications, and treatment interruptions. There were a variety of reasons for treatment interruptions, including weekends and holidays. In previous studies that focused on claims, these variables were not considered.

For an initial evaluation you can decide to see a private psychiatrist. The cost can range from PS300 to PS700. A follow-up appointment will cost about 150PS. Your doctor will send a letter to your GP after the assessment is complete.

If you decide to go to a private practitioner it is important to be prepared to make several sessions with a doctor. They'll check for co-morbidities, and ask for evidence from family members.

In the UK, Psychiatry-UK has contracts to provide NHS-funded Adult ADHD assessments. They also have contracts to supply private prescriptions for non-ADHD medicines.

The NICE ADHD Guidelines were updated. While the guidelines are useful but have done nothing to increase the amount of money invested in ADHD services. It is hoped that more resources will be allotted to ADHD treatment.
